Understanding Metacarpal Fractures: A Complete Guide
A metacarpal fracture occurs when one or more of the bones in your hand, known as metacarpals, crack. These fractures often arise due to a direct blow to the hand, such as during sports or a fall. Grasping Whooping Cough: A Comprehensive Guide
Whooping cough, medically known as pertussis, is a highly contagious respiratory illness. It's identified with severe coughing fits that often end in a characteristic "whooping".
